41-year-old man shot dead in Back of the Yards

A man was shot to death Tuesday afternoon in the Back of the Yards neighborhood on the South Side.

Shortly before 5 p.m., a man walked up to 41-year-old Calvin Robinson in the 5200 block of South Bishop and fired shots, according to Chicago Police and the Cook County medical examiner’s office.

Robinson suffered multiple gunshot wounds to the body and was pronounced dead at the scene at 5:13 p.m., authorities said. He lived about two blocks from the shooting.

The suspect was black man, thought to be between 25 and 30 years old, wearing a white shirt and red pants, police said.

Area Central detectives were conducting a homicide investigation.
